Core Skills Analysis

Art

  • Improved fine motor skills through precise placement of diamond beads.
  • Enhanced creativity by selecting colors and patterns for the design.
  • Learned about visual composition by arranging diamond beads to create a balanced image.
  • Explored texture through the tactile experience of placing and pressing diamond beads.

Tips

Engage your child in discussions about the cultural significance of the art they are creating in diamond art. Encourage them to research different art styles and artists to inspire their future projects. Consider incorporating music related to the art theme to enhance the creative atmosphere during the activity. Lastly, display their finished diamond art pieces proudly to boost their confidence and sense of accomplishment.
